Output d3bcdb5fee82e7f7be3053377cd49014c42f80e8b37e7b6aba6b5bc72fa2322d:0

value
36321336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4787f4d93b386d8dc26aa88a36d01a77bd958c6 OP_EQUAL
address
3J9FuNTmxAWani5h1xFLNi3DjA2ctjC1Qh
transaction
d3bcdb5fee82e7f7be3053377cd49014c42f80e8b37e7b6aba6b5bc72fa2322d
confirmations
395905
spent
true